
如果您有多个摄像头,可以尝试 1、2 等索引。 然而,在多核CPU环境下运行程序时,我们发现最终的字符计数结果并不稳定,每次运行都可能得到不同的值,而在单核环境下却能保持一致。 在 for 或 while 循环中频繁递增计数器本身几乎不耗内存 但如果循环体内创建了新变量、数组元素或对象实例,内存会持...

结合表格驱动测试使用 t.Run 最常见且推荐的方式是将 t.Run 与表格驱动测试(table-driven tests)结合使用。 高效传递数据: 作为函数参数传递时,切片只拷贝其轻量级的头部结构,避免了大型数据拷贝的开销。 myScriptResult = AppleScriptTask("m...

$decimals: 要保留的小数位数,默认为 0。 1. 标准化目录结构与编码规范加速团队协作;2. 自动化工具如Artisan实现一键生成代码、数据库迁移;3. 代码生成器快速构建CRUD接口,支持模板定制;4. 统一的配置管理与自动加载机制简化开发流程。 volatile关键字的作用 vola...

简单来说,闭包是指一个函数能够访问并记住其外部作用域中的变量,即使外部函数已经执行完毕。 本文将探讨如何在AWS API Gateway和Lambda架构下,通过Bearer Token进行身份验证。 不复杂但容易忽略细节,比如扩展名混淆或服务未启动。 数组是值类型,当数组作为参数传递给函数时,会创...

集成Prometheus+Grafana监控指标,Filebeat+ES+Kibana统一日志,OpenTelemetry/Jaeger追踪调用链,ConfigMap/Secret管理配置。 示例代码<?php // 模拟从 get_user_meta 获取的邮箱数组 $emails_arra...

如果您的PHP环境与Sagepay期望的行结束符不符,也可能导致解析问题。 教程将详细介绍如何通过setTimeZone()方法,将DateTime对象从UTC正确地转换为目标本地时区,确保时间表示的准确性与一致性。 如果类只包含基本数据类型或标准库对象(如std::string、std::vect...

不复杂但容易忽略细节,比如Go模块代理、交叉编译依赖等,建议在团队内部文档中明确说明。 本文将提供详细的步骤和示例代码,帮助您轻松实现这一目标。 这个方法会移除容器中的所有元素,使容器变为空,同时保持其容量不变。 joined := strings.Join([]string{"a", "b", "...

这样,即使$html_output`包含多行内容和换行符,JavaScript也能将其作为一个合法的多行字符串字面量来解析,而不会抛出语法错误。 "); } // 列出 $room 目录中的所有文件和目录 $files = scandir($room); // 遍历目录中的每个条目 foreach ...

通过仔细检查这些环节,并利用Django提供的调试工具(如form_invalid方法),可以有效地诊断并解决此类问题,从而构建一个功能完善且健壮的用户资料管理系统。 泛型支持: 如果Go版本支持泛型,可以编写一个泛型函数来处理不同值类型的map[string]T到map[int]T的转换,提高代码...

3. 使用 shrink_to_fit()(C++11起) C++11引入了shrink_to_fit(),请求容器减少capacity到当前size: 存了个图 视频图片解析/字幕/剪辑,视频高清保存/图片源图提取 17 查看详情 vec.clear(); vec.shrink_to_fit();...